1. Binance
Binance is one of the world’s largest and most popular cryptocurrency exchanges. It offers a comprehensive range of services, including spot trading, futures, margin trading, and staking. For Indonesian users, Binance provides a localized platform that supports IDR (Indonesian Rupiah) deposits and withdrawals. Its robust security measures, extensive selection of cryptocurrencies, and advanced trading tools make it a top choice.

Key Features:

  • Wide Range of Cryptocurrencies: Binance supports a vast array of digital assets.
  • Advanced Trading Tools: Features such as futures contracts and margin trading.
  • Local Support: IDR trading pairs and localized customer service.
  • High Liquidity: Ensures better trading conditions and faster order execution.
  • Mobile App: Available for trading on the go.

2. Tokocrypto
Tokocrypto is a prominent Indonesian exchange known for its user-friendly interface and strong regulatory compliance. It provides a seamless experience for buying, selling, and trading cryptocurrencies in IDR. Tokocrypto’s focus on user experience and local market needs makes it a preferred choice among Indonesian traders.

Key Features:

  • IDR Integration: Facilitates easy transactions in local currency.
  • User-Friendly Interface: Designed to cater to both beginners and experienced traders.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Adheres to local regulations ensuring safer trading.
  • Educational Resources: Offers tutorials and guides for new users.

3. Indodax
Indodax is another leading cryptocurrency exchange in Indonesia, offering a comprehensive range of digital assets and trading options. It stands out for its high security standards and extensive selection of local and international cryptocurrencies. The platform is designed to be accessible for both new and experienced users, with a focus on community engagement and support.

Key Features:

  • Security Measures: Advanced security protocols to safeguard user assets.
  • Extensive Cryptocurrency Selection: A broad range of cryptocurrencies available for trading.
  • Community Focus: Active community and customer support services.
  • Local Integration: Supports transactions in IDR and local banking systems.

4. Pintu
Pintu is a newer player in the Indonesian market but has quickly gained traction due to its innovative approach and commitment to user education. It provides a streamlined trading experience with a strong emphasis on mobile usability and educational resources. Pintu is particularly appealing to beginners looking for an easy entry into cryptocurrency trading.

Key Features:

  • Mobile-Focused: Designed for efficient mobile trading.
  • Educational Resources: Provides extensive guides and resources for new traders.
  • Simple Interface: Easy to navigate for beginners.
  • Security Features: Emphasis on protecting user information and assets.

5. Upbit Indonesia
Upbit, originally a South Korean exchange, has made a significant impact in Indonesia with its high liquidity and extensive trading options. The platform offers a robust suite of tools for traders looking for advanced features and high-volume trading. Upbit’s reputation for security and innovation adds to its appeal for Indonesian users.

Key Features:

  • High Liquidity: Ensures smooth trading and competitive pricing.
  • Advanced Trading Tools: Suitable for experienced traders.
  • Security Protocols: Comprehensive measures to protect user funds.
  • International Access: Offers access to global cryptocurrency markets.

Choosing the Right Exchange
When selecting a cryptocurrency exchange, consider factors such as security, fees, available cryptocurrencies, and user experience. Security should be a top priority, as exchanges that employ robust measures can protect you from potential losses. Fees vary widely among platforms, and understanding the fee structure can help you save on transaction costs. Additionally, a wide selection of cryptocurrencies allows you to diversify your portfolio and access various investment opportunities.
